About the instructor

Kassem Lahham is a 'Senior Private Banker' and 'Banking Consultant', who lives and works between Europe, the MENA and the GCC regions. He is fluent in German, English, French and Arabic and has more than 30 years’ of experience in International Private Banking, Wealth Management and Wealth- & Legacy Planning which he gained at highly renowned International financial institutions. Throughout his career, Mr. Lahham has specialized in Wealth- and Asset Management, Mergers & Acquisitions and developed a loyal client base in the MENA and GCC regions, Europe & Asia. He also has experience in Team Leading and Business Development which goes beyond SPV solutions. He also holds a professional Teacher Certificate in Finance & Banking issued by the German Chamber of Commerce along MBA & PhD from the USA & German Dipl. in Banking Economics. Furthermore, he is beyond others a Guest Professor at the famous Gulf University for Science and Technology (GUST) and the great American University of Kuwait (AUK) in Kuwait lecturing for the Finance- & Banking sector. He fully understands how to educate and sell easy to complicated structures in the Wealth Management & Planning fields to HNWI & KEY clients in the MENA & GCC regions by sharing his experience with his audience, colleagues & team members. A practical individual & entrepreneur, he adores his work & enjoys building and developing.
